What people and households earn each week, and how incomes are spread.
Almost half of all residents in Mount Doran earn under $650 a week, reflecting a community where incomes are generally low. The typical weekly family income of $1,708 is well below the Victorian figure, and very few households earn high weekly wages.

Median personal, family and household incomes.
Weekly personal income is much lower than most areas, with a typical figure of $587. This is well below the national figure of $805, while typical household incomes sit a little below the Victorian average at $1,520.

High earners and the full distribution.
High earners are rare here, as only 7.8% of households earn $3,000 or more a week, which is far below the national figure of 22.6%. Most households earn between $650 and $2,999 per week.
